Swimming Pig

The swimming pigs of the Bahamas have become one of the Caribbean's most iconic and unusual attractions. These feral domestic pigs inhabit Big Major Cay (now known as 'Pig Beach') in the Exuma Cays, where they swim out to meet visiting boats in hopes of food. Their origin remains debated—theories include being left by sailors, surviving a shipwreck, or being placed there by locals.

Wskazówki dla nurków

The swimming pigs are a snorkelling activity, not a dive. Bring food (the boat operators provide it) and enter the water slowly. The pigs are enthusiastic and can be pushy. Protect cameras and valuables. Visit early morning before the tourist crowds for a calmer experience.
